Interventional Pain Physician
Memphis, TN
Currently seeking a full-time Interventional Pain Physician to join an established outpatient pain management team serving multiple clinics and an ASC in the Greater Memphis area (TN/MS). This is an employed, outpatient role within a comprehensive, patient-focused pain practice using cutting-edge technology.
Benefits for the Interventional Pain Physician
$450,000 - $550,000 guaranteed base compensation year 1 + collections with productivity bonuses and partnership potential
Sign-on and relocation bonus
Comprehensive benefits (medical, dental, vision, 401(k), life/AD&D, disability)
CME, licensing, and malpractice covered
Generous paid time off
Responsibilities of the Interventional Pain Physician
Provide comprehensive, multi-disciplinary pain management care; may supervise APPs (ARNPs/Physician Assistants).
Create patient-focused, safe, and balanced treatment plans.
Perform/problem-focused physical exams and obtain medical histories to assess injury, disease, chronic pain, or disabling conditions.
Determine, order, and interpret appropriate diagnostic studies (including radiology and labs).
Implement evidence-based treatments for chronic pain (e.g., medications, nerve blocks, electrical stimulation, and other interventional therapies).
Perform procedures primarily at a nearby outpatient single-specialty surgery center with staff experienced in chronic pain procedures.
Maintain accurate, timely, and complete electronic health records; initiate consultations/referrals when needed.
Monitor patient progress and adjust treatment plans as necessary.
Counsel patients and families on conditions, medications (including interactions), and health promotion; support long-term care needs.
Direct, support, and collaborate with Advanced Practice Providers.
Participate in practice growth via marketing, educational, and community engagements.
Adhere to HIPAA and maintain strict confidentiality.
Requirements of the Interventional Pain Physician
MD or DO (or foreign equivalent).
Board-Eligible or Board-Certified in Pain Medicine, Anesthesiology, PM&R, or related field.
Completed (or in process of completing) an ACGME-accredited Pain Medicine Fellowship.
Active, unrestricted Medical License and DEA in Tennessee and Mississippi, or willingness to obtain.
Current BLS/ACLS certifications.
